A dog-friendly café near us has a sign outside it, apparently aimed at dogs. It’s certainly low enough for most dogs to see but I’m not sure how many dogs can read.

It says, “Take a stick, Leave a stick”. And there is, indeed, a fine collection of sticks at the foot of the sign.

It remined me of the advice offered to hikers.

“Take nothing but photographs. Leave nothing but footprints”.

Reflection   

Wherever we go we will give and take something. May we gently take what’s on offer and graciously give of ourselves.
